最新公告
  • 欢迎您光临 我爱模板网,本站秉承服务宗旨 履行“站长”责任,销售只是起点 服务永无止境! 立即加入钻石VIP
  • psc怎么导出mysql

    正文概述 管理员   2025-09-05   8

    要将PSC(PowerSchool)中的数据导出至MySQL数据库,可以按照以下步骤进行操作:

    步骤1:设置MySQL数据库

    首先,确保已正确安装和配置MySQL数据库。如果尚未安装MySQL,请在官方网站(https://www.mysql.com/)下载并按照安装指南进行安装。

    步骤2:创建数据库和表

    在MySQL中,创建一个用于存储PSC数据的数据库和表。可以使用MySQL命令行工具或可视化工具(如phpMyAdmin)来执行下面的SQL语句:

    ```sql

    CREATE DATABASE psc_data;

    USE psc_data;

    CREATE TABLE students (

    id INT PRIMARY KEY AUTO_INCREMENT,

    name VARCHAR(100),

    grade INT,

    age INT

    );

    以上代码创建了一个名为psc_data的数据库,并在其中创建了一个名为students的表,该表包含了学生的id、姓名、年级和年龄字段。

    步骤3:连接到PSC数据库

    使用合适的MySQL连接库(如MySQL Connector/Python)连接到PSC数据库。根据不同的编程语言,具体的连接方式可能会有所不同。在连接到PSC数据库后,可以执行查询语句来获取需要导出的数据。

    步骤4:导出数据并插入到MySQL

    将从PSC数据库中获取的数据转换为合适的格式,并逐行将数据插入到MySQL数据库中。以下是一个示例代码片段,演示了如何导出学生数据并插入到MySQL数据库中:

    ```python

    import mysql.connector

    # 连接到PSC数据库

    psc_conn = mysql.connector.connect(

    host='psc_host',

    user='psc_user',

    password='psc_password',

    database='psc_database'

    )

    psc_cursor = psc_conn.cursor()

    # 执行查询语句获取学生数据

    psc_cursor.execute('SELECT id, name, grade, age FROM students')

    # 连接到MySQL数据库

    mysql_conn = mysql.connector.connect(

    host='mysql_host',

    user='mysql_user',

    password='mysql_password',

    database='psc_data'

    )

    mysql_cursor = mysql_conn.cursor()

    # 逐行插入数据到MySQL数据库

    for (id, name, grade, age) in psc_cursor:

    mysql_cursor.execute('INSERT INTO students (id, name, grade, age) VALUES (%s, %s, %s, %s)', (id, name, grade, age))

    mysql_conn.commit()

    # 关闭数据库连接

    psc_cursor.close()

    psc_conn.close()

    mysql_cursor.close()

    mysql_conn.close()

    请根据实际情况修改代码中的数据库连接参数。

    步骤5:验证数据导入

    在导入完成后,可以使用合适的MySQL客户端(如phpMyAdmin)或编程语言中的MySQL连接库进行验证,确认数据已成功导入到MySQL数据库中。

    以上是一种将PSC数据导出至MySQL数据库的基本方法。根据具体的需求和环境,可能需要做一些进一步的调整和优化。


    我爱模板网 » psc怎么导出mysql

    发表评论

    如需帝国cms功能定制以及二次开发请联系我们

    联系作者
    script> var _hmt = _hmt || []; (function() { var hm = document.createElement("script"); hm.src = "https://hm.baidu.com/hm.js?587cc1e5c052b5b0ce99533beff13c96"; var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(hm, s); })();

    请选择支付方式

    ×
    支付宝支付
    余额支付
    ×
    微信扫码支付 0 元